How to create a secure confidential format

When it comes to keeping your confidential information safe and sound, there are a number of different ways to go about it. One option is to use a secure confidential format. A secure confidential format uses a variety of security measures to protect your information from unauthorized access.

One way to create a secure confidential format is to use a variety of encryption tools. Encryption helps to protect your information from being accessed by unauthorized individuals. Many encryption tools also employ cryptographic algorithms that make it difficult for anyone to decode the data. This makes it difficult for anyone to access your information without first obtaining the correct key.

Another way to create a secure confidential format is to use a password manager. A password manager is an app or software that helps keep track of your passwords. It also stores them in a secure location, so that they are not easily accessible to unauthorized individuals.

However, it is not just the use of encryption and passwords that is important when creating a secure confidential format. It is also important to use a variety of security measures when accessing your confidential information. For example, you should always protect your computer using a firewall, and you should always keep your confidential information off public computers or networks.

By using a secure confidential format and taking various security measures, you can ensure that your information remains safe and sound.
